Score! World Cup fans get free soccer-themed condoms to help them play the field

Safe sex is the gooooal!

World Cup fans in Toronto will get thousands of free, soccer-themed condoms when the city hosts the much-anticipated tournament this summer — to help them score safely.

Soccer buffs partying in Hogtown can play the field with six “limited edition” rubbers featuring sports puns such as “What a finish!’,” “Block those shots!” and “Ohhh, Canada.” 

“Get ready to score safely,” city health officials said on X. “Whether you’re attending a soccer match, a watch party, hitting a summer festival or partying, remember that condoms protect the health of you and your partner(s).”

Innuendo-packed condom designs include an image of an emoji-style peach standing in a soccer goal,  blocking an eggplant as it tries to kick a ball into her “net,” along with images of players shielding their junk during a penalty kick.

The “game day line up” is meant to “promote safer sex, reduce stigma and connect people with sexual health services,” said Toronto Public Health, which is spearheading the giveaway.

The condoms will be given away at clinics and sites around the city “while supplies last.”

Toronto is one of 16 host cities across Canada, Mexico and the US that will host World Cup games in June and July, ending with the July 19 final at MetLife Stadium in East Rutherford, NJ.
